HVAC Energy Savings: These South Shore Offices Cut Their Bill in Half in Just One Year

A strategic HVAC installation that transformed this commercial building’s energy consumption

The striking example we’re sharing today involves an office building located on Montréal’s South Shore, where we carried out a complete overhaul of the heating, ventilation, and air conditioning system. The result: the client was able to cut their annual energy bill by 50% — a real, measurable, and sustainable savings.

Understanding the specific needs of an office building

When the property manager in Longueuil first contacted us, the goal was crystal clear: upgrade the aging and energy-intensive central system while ensuring optimal comfort for all tenants. After conducting a complete energy audit, we identified several critical issues:

  • An outdated electric boiler over 20 years old

  • A complete lack of efficient zoning

  • Obsolete rooftop units with no heat recovery

  • Manual, decentralized temperature controls

The challenge was to install a high-efficiency HVAC system, smart enough to adapt to fluctuating schedules and multiple occupancy zones, all while remaining fully compliant with commercial building codes.

Our solution: A centralized HVAC system with high energy efficiency

We chose to install a Bosch BOVA 2.0 Inverter central heat pump system with multi-zone configuration, combined with Goodman R-32 air handlers and a commercial-grade HRV (heat recovery ventilation) system tailored to commercial environments.

Components installed:

  • 2 Bosch BOVA 2.0 Inverter units (60,000 BTU each) with variable-speed compressors

  • 3 Goodman R-32 air handlers (36,000, 48,000, and 60,000 BTU respectively)

  • Venmar AVS commercial ventilation system with integrated HRV and MERV 13 filters

  • Smart thermostats connected to a centralized building management platform

  • Custom zoning by floor with automatic temperature control

Thanks to this hybrid system, energy is consumed only when and where it’s needed, maintaining high efficiency even during deep freezes — a crucial advantage during Québec winters.

Installation process: coordination, precision, and flexibility

Key stages:

  1. Planning and energy analysis: Airflow measurement and thermal simulations by zone

  2. Jobsite preparation without business disruption: Installations were done during off-hours and weekends to avoid disturbing tenants

  3. Mechanical installation: Rooftop mounting using a crane, connection to existing ducts, fine-tuned calibration of each zone

  4. Commissioning and smart system setup: Integration into an online platform allowing real-time monitoring for the property manager

Challenges faced:

  • Limited rooftop access due to an older building structure

  • Poor insulation in certain ductwork areas, which we resolved to improve thermal efficiency

  • Reconfiguration of the building’s electrical setup to accommodate the new variable-speed compressors

Results: Substantial savings and optimal comfort

Less than a year after installation, our client reported:

  • A 52% reduction in heating and cooling costs, compared to the previous year

  • Improved thermal comfort in all office spaces, thanks to intelligent zoning

  • Noticeable noise reduction, with the new units being significantly quieter

  • Fewer service calls, thanks to predictive maintenance made easy through the smart platform

Additionally, the project qualified for Hydro-Québec’s LogisVert grants, with over $8,000 in financial incentives for upgrading to energy-efficient equipment and replacing legacy CFC-based systems.

Why are these results so impressive?

Because this transformation wasn’t just about replacing machines. It was based on a deep understanding of thermal flows, occupancy patterns, and the technology best suited for a commercial environment.

Many property managers hesitate to invest in major HVAC upgrades due to upfront costs. But in this case, the return on investment was achieved in under three years, not to mention increased tenant satisfaction and property value.
